Fair Showcases Study Abroad Options聽

The Office of International Programs (OIP) held its annual Study Abroad Fair on September 24, showcasing international opportunities for 2025.聽

OIP staff, faculty who are leading Meredith Abroad programs, representatives from affiliate programs, and students who serve as study abroad peer ambassadors were all on hand to share information and answer questions.聽

Meredith Abroad options include a variety of faculty-led programs based in Meredith鈥檚 location in Sansepolcro, Italy. One option is a spring semester course called Intersections: Math, Art, and Italy that includes travel to Italy over spring break. The deadline to apply for this program is October 15.

First-year students may be especially interested in the Fall 2025 Semester in Italy program, where participants can completely fulfill their foreign language requirement and earn a full semester of general education credits applicable to all majors.聽

Meredith Abroad is celebrating 50 years of faculty-led study abroad programs this year. The first official study abroad program at Meredith was a program in the United Kingdom in the summer of 1974. Students in 2025 have the opportunity to follow in the footsteps of that first program with a summer opportunity in London. Students can also combine the June Italy program with the July London program, called the 鈥淲hole Program,鈥 for a unique opportunity to earn 12 credits in seven weeks.聽
